Making actions adjust to your image {Photoshop Stuff}

Monday, February 6th, 2012

As you know, most actions that are used will need to be adjusted to your images and thankfully actions have been created with layers which help in doing so! I, however, wanted to go beyond the usual reducing/adding opacity in layers to showing you my step by step process on this particular image below.

For the shot below, since it was taken in the Fall, I wanted more “Fall” colors so I chose Citrus Orange from my Sweet & Sleek set knowing it would give me some good orange and red tones.

jean photography

I pressed “play” on Citrus Orange and then all the steps below!
